WHO decries deadly attack on only functioning hospital in Sudan's El-Fasher

People lift national flags and placards during a rally called for by Sudan's Popular Front for Liberation and Justice in Port Sudan on April 24, 2025, to denounce the siege imposed by the paramilitary Rapid Support Forces (RSF) on El-Fasher city and express support for its residents. Since April 2023, the war between the army and the RSF has killed tens of thousands, uprooted 13 million and created what the UN describes as the world's worst humanitarian crisis. El-Fasher, the state capital of North Darfur, remains the last major city in the vast Darfur region that the paramilitary group has not conquered. (Photo by AFP)

The head of the World Health Organization said Monday that the only even partially functioning hospital in the Sudanese city of El-Fasher had been attacked, urging an immediate end to hostilities.

The Saudi Maternity Hospital “was attacked again yesterday. Reports say one nurse lost her life and three additional health workers have been injured,” Tedros Adhanom Ghebreyesus said on X, lamenting that a communication blackout meant “we cannot verify further developments at and around the hospital”.
